Despite the low flows, the clouds ahead of Dorian yesterday and the cooler, longer nights are turning things back on, it seems. Nice too see the reports trickling in again! This one was from a certain very pressured Northampton County limestoner. Hand-measured at over 18 and beefy. Nymphed about 10 fish close to cover with a pink tag fly and a perdigon or drowned ant on the dropper. Leaf hatch starting, and not just the sycamores. Felt like a fall day. I know the heat can't be over, but it was nice to pretend yesterday! Two shots of same fish below:
